The Basics: What Is a Liter and a Quart?
Before diving in, let’s clarify the units:
- Liter (L): A metric unit equal to 1,000 cubic centimeters (cm³). It’s widely used for liquids worldwide.
- Quart (Q): An imperial unit roughly equal to 0.946 liters. It’s common in the U.S. and UK for measuring fuel, beverages, and bulk quantities.
